Customer understanding

It is vital for brands to understand and respond to evolving customers’ needs to remain relevant and stay ahead of the competition.

We work with businesses helping them to get under the skin of current and target customers so you can develop strategies designed around their needs.

We know that every customer group is different. That’s why we’ll partner with you to develop a tailored approach that will work for your target audience. Drawing on our vast toolkit of qualitative and quantitative methodologies, we’ll find the right techniques to meet your needs – whether that’s understanding how your product is used in home via an online community or exploring how consumers perceive your brand through TDIs. By bringing you closer to your customers in this way, we can embed rich understanding across your organization to facilitate customer-centric decision-making.
